Yogi Babu's Mandela And Vidya Balan's Sherni Among 14 Films Shortlist For India's Entry To The Academy Awards

Chennai, October 22 - Yogi Babu's acclaimed political satire comedy-drama film "Mandela" is among the 14 films shortlisted for India's entry to the Academy Awards 2022. Yogi Babu, who has become a popular name in Tamil cinema, won praise for his role in the film, which is set on the backdrop of a village panchayat election scenario between two political parties where a local barber's vote will determine the fate of the election. ## Apart from Mandela, Vidya Balan starrer "Sherni" has also been named on the list. In the film, directed by Amit V. Masurkar, Vidya plays an upright forest officer battling social barriers set by the patriarchal society and lackadaisical attitudes within her department. The movie was released directly on Amazon Prime Video and was one of the top-rated films on the streamer. ## Vicky Kaushal's recently released biographical historical drama, Sardar Udham, will also be battling out to become India's official entry in next year's Oscars. The direct-to-digital release is based on the life of Udham Singh, a revolutionary freedom fighter known for assassinating Michael O'Dwyer in London to avenge the 1919 Jallianwala Bagh massacre in Amritsar. Directed by Shoojit Sircar, Sardar Udham is one of the highest-rated Indian films of 2021 on IMDb. ## Among the 14 films, Joju George, Nimisha Sajayan, and Kunchacko Boban's Malayalam film, Nayattu, has also made the cut on the list. Directed by Martin Prakkat, the movie received critical attention at the time for its tightly packed script and great performances of the actors, though there has been some criticism of its take on caste. ## The 14 selected films from across industries have reached the jury in Kolkata which contains 15 members. Filmmaker Shaji N Karun is the Chairman of the jury who will select India's final entry to the Academy Awards for the category Best International Film category. Oscars will take place in March 2022 for its 94th edition. ## Stay tuned...

Vicky Kaushal's Sardar Udham Singh Takes Direct-To-Digital Route On Amazon Prime Video

Mumbai, September 12, 2021: Vicky Kaushal starrer long-awaited biographical film "Sardar Udham Singh" becomes the latest Bollywood biggie to take the direct-to-digital route. Directed by Shoojit Sircar, the movie has been ready for release for quite some time now. ## The producers of the film were reportedly not willing to hold the release of the film anymore and they have sold the movie to Amazon Prime Video. On Thursday, Amazon Prime Video officially announced the premiere of the film in October this year.## you know the man but not his story.bringing to you the story of India's freedom fighter, this october.watch #SardarUdhamOnPrime@vickykaushal09 #ShoojitSircar @ronnielahiri #SheelKumar @writish #ShubenduBhattacharya @filmsrisingsun @Kinoworksllp @veerakapur7 @BanitaSandhu pic.twitter.com/MB4xSWpiAx— amazon prime video IN (@PrimeVideoIN) September 23, 2021 ## It is said that director Shoojit Sircar and co. had sold Gulabo Sitabo to Amazon Prime Video in the early days of the pandemic only because they could hold on to Sardar Udham Singh for a theatrical release. However, with Maharashtra theaters are yet to open, the makers have taken this tough call to release the movie on Prime Video. ## Vicky Kaushal plays the role of Udham Singh, a revolutionary freedom fighter best known for assassinating Michael O'Dwyer in London to take revenge for the 1919 Jallianwala Bagh massacre in Amritsar. The movie also stars Banita Sandhu as the female lead. It is produced by Ronnie Lahiri and Sheel Kumar. ## While the shoot of Sardar Udham Singh was wrapped up in December 2019, the team took almost a year and a half of the post-production. ## Stay tuned...

Vicky Kaushal, Kiara Advani, And Bhumi Pednekar In Shashank Khaitan's Next?

Filmmaker Shashank Khaitan was set to direct Varun Dhawan and Janhvi Kapoor in the comedy film, Mr. Lele. The makers even released a poster of the film with a title featuring Dhawan, however, the movie was shelved last year around this time after Varun Dhawan reportedly expressed his displeasure over the script. ## Now, Shashank Khaitan is reviving the project but not with Varun and Janhvi. According to a leading entertainment portal, Vicky Kaushal has been roped in to play the role which was supposed to be played by Dhawan. The film, which is no longer titled Mr. Lele, is said to have two leading actresses in Kiara Advani and Bhumi Pednekar. ## While the official announcement is due, the movie with a new title went on floors last week with Vicky and Kiara while Bhumi, who recently completed the social comedy "Badhai Do" with Rajkummar Rao, will join them soon. ## Khaitan's film will be Kaushal's first comedy movie and second film with Kiara Advani after the 2018 anthology "Lust Stories" with their segment being directed by Karan Johar. Meanwhile, Vicky will be seen in Vijay Krishna Acharya's next with Manushi Chhillar, in Shoojit Sircar's Sardar Udham, Aditya Dhar's The Immortal Ashwathama, and in the Sam Manekshaw biopic. ## On the other hand, Kiara Advani has Jug Jugg Jeeyo, Shershaah and Bhool Bhulaiyaa 2 in the pipeline while Bhumi Pednekar has Badhaai Do coming up next. She has already starred with Vicky earlier in Bhoot – Part 1: The Haunted Ship. ## Stay tuned...
